“The hotel is an excellent place for anyone looking to stay near the airport. It has shuttle service but its located in a quieter neighborhood which allows for a great night sleep. The restaurant on-site is excellent and provides room service at a small additional charge- this is ideal for business travelers. The hotel has a pool and jacuzzi which makes relaxing after a long day very easy.”

“The hotel was clean and the staff was friendly/helpful. This is an older hotel and needs to be renovated very soon. The bathrooms were small and there were no microwaves or fridges in the rooms (note: the hotel has fridges that they will bring up to your room but there is a limited amount). With small children these things are needed. The actual room was a very good size for a family of four.”

“The beds are comfortable but this is an old hotel. They are currently renovating which is desperately needed. The restaurant was surprisingly good with large portions on the kids menu - definitely enough to fill an older child (11-12). Breakfast was free for kids 12 and under with an adult purchase. Lunch and dinner was reasonably priced.”
